The company's adjusted trial balance includes the following accounts balances: Cash, $15,000; Equipment, $85,000; Accumulated Depreciation, $25,000; Accounts Payable, $10,000; Retained earnings, $63,500; Dividends, $2,000; Sales, $56,000; Sales Returns and Allowances, $3,000; Sales Discounts, $1,500; Depreciation Expense, $25,000; and Salaries Expense, $23,000. All accounts have normal balances. Prepare the second closing entry by selecting the account names from the pull-down menus and entering dollar amounts in the debit and credit columns.

Explanation:

Preparation of the second closing entry

Based on the information given the second closing entry will be :

Dr Income summary 52,500

(3,000+1,500+25,000+23,000)

Cr Sales Returns and Allowances 3,000

Cr Sales Discounts 1,500

Cr Depreciation Expense 25,000

Cr Salaries Expense 23,000

(Being To record closing of expenses and contra sales accounts
